    computer: pavilion A6040n
    Radeon R7 240 graphics card
    Note: the graphics card is Pci-e 3.0 16x in a Pci-e 16x slot on the motherboard

    I have the computer connected to a Avera 43AER20 TV through the VGA port.

    Once the computer shuts off the signal to the screen, which happens after 15 minutes of inactivity, I can't get the picture to come back, when I press on the mouse or keyboard. I tried with a traditional monitor and it works fine.

    I found a way to get the picture to come up. When I don't get the picture that I should, I connected the TV to the HDMI port. That HDMI port then outputs "second monitor"output to the TV. In other words, it treats the HDMI as a second monitor and shows the desktop without the shortcuts and the recycling bin. From there, I change the TV, which is plugged into the HDMI port, to be the primary display. Obviously, this is an overly complicated process just to wake the computer up. But, maybe it sheds some light on the issue (I don't know how but maybe a light bulb goes on for someone).
